We are seeking a skilled and motivated qualified Crane Engineer to join a leading company specialising in the maintenance and repair of overhead cranes and hoists. This is a fantastic opportunity for someone with strong electro-mechanical knowledge and first-hand experience in a similar field.
What’s on Offer:
- Basic Salary: £38,000 - £45,000 per annum working a 40-hour week
- Overtime: Paid on travel (home to home)
- Company van, fuel card, tools, and PPE provided.
- A stable, mobile role with varied daily tasks and excellent career growth potential.
Key Responsibilities:
- Conduct routine maintenance, servicing, and repair of Overhead, Gantry cranes and hoists to ensure optimal functionality.
- Perform Pre-Delivery Inspections (PDI) to maintain high equipment standards.
- Attend customer sites promptly to diagnose and resolve breakdowns.
- Working on a call out rota (Bonus payable) and hours worked during call outs are paid at double time.
The Ideal Candidate Will Have:
- Strong electrical knowledge and relevant certifications (e.g., 18th Edition).
- Electrically qualified ideally apprentice trained with NVQ qualification in Electrical Engineering
- Proven experience in a similar role (e.g., cranes, powered access, plant machinery, or material handling equipment).
- Full UK driving license and willingness to travel.
- Ability to work at heights and familiarity with LOLER regulations.
